------------------------------- July 31, 2006 Unapproved draft minutes of the Annual Meeting as supplied by Lang. There are at least three mistakes which will be corrected when received by PORI. PGA VILLAGE PROPERTY OWNERS ASSOCIATION, INC.
BOARD OF DIRECTORS ANNUAL MEETING
WEDNESDAY, JULY 26, 2006 9:00 AM
In the WANAMAKER ROOM PGA VILLAGE PORT ST. LUCIE, FL
MINUTES
Present from the Board of Directors were John Csapo, President and Kevin Voller, Treasurer. Steve Brown represented Lang Management. Frank Smarkola represented Wackenhut Security and Stacy McElroy represented Dean, Mead, Et al.
Call to Order: Meeting was called to order by Steve Brown of Lang Management at 9:00 am.
Reappointment of Board: The developer controlled board was introduced as President, John Csapo; Vice President/Secretary, George Fingulin; Treasurer, Kevin Voller.
Approval of 2005 Annual Meeting Minutes: A motion was made by John Csapo to approve the minutes as presented; Seconded by Kevin Voller; all were in favor.
Hearing and Security Committees: Steve asked all homeowners that would like to be considered for these committees to please sign the sheets at the rear of the room and the Board will make a decision in the next 30 days and contact them.
Open Floor:
When will FPL install lights in communities not yet completed? (A letter will be sent by Kolter to FPL asking for a time table for installation.)
Can the Board increase penalties for speeding in the community to include suspension of transponder for excessive first time speeding? (The Board will consider)
Will Master Board work with homeowner on setting up community channel? (Sue Furman is to contact Steve Brown on this issue.)
Is Kolter going to correct the standing water in the Lakes and correct the drain plugs that are a tripping hazard? (Bob From to look into drainage and drain plugs)
Is there a contact person for irrigation issues that happen over the weekend? (Yes, the guards have the emergency numbers)
Will the transponders given to construction be turned off as construction is completed? (Lang will provide Kolter with a list of contractors and transponders will be turned off if necessary)
Will chain fence come down between Verano and PGA? (A wall will replace the fence.)
When will the entrance columns be completed? (Within 45 days)
What will the Island Club consist of? (Swimming pool, tennis courts, approximate total of 2600 sq. ft.)
Letter from Bill Hammer on Island Club (Attached)
Letter from Susan Ashman (Attached)
Will the pool at the Island Club have a fence around it? (Yes)
Is Kolter using homeowner on Association property to fill county requirements? (Kolter is still working with the County and any property used must be deeded to the Master Association.)
Will swipe cards in Castle Pines still work after August 31st? (If your card is dated to go past August 31st, yes. There is a possibility of a company taking the rental program over and handling the swipe card system.)
Will the West Gate House be remodeled this year given it is in the budget? (If not done this year, it will not be assessed again; next year the funds collected will be used to build it.)
In Kingsmill II, homeowners are concerned about dead pines behind their homes. (Bob Fromm will contact PGA Golf on this issued.)
Will the berm between Willow Pines and the CDD be filled in? (Kolter to look at and report back to James Zaharako.)
The North Gate is a security problem, can something be done? (Kolter will send a mailing to homeowners with different options for this gate.)
In some communities there is still construction debris in preserve berms. (Kolter will have debris removed)
Can the Annual Meeting be rescheduled for January or a time when more homeowners are down? (The Board will consider)
There being no further business to be conducted, on duly motion, the meeting was adjourned at 10:00 am.

June 20, 2005 The Annual meeting of the PGA Property Owner's Association meeting was held this morning at the Wanamaker Room at the PGA Golf Club. The former board members were John Csapo, John Thompson, and Bob Vail. They all resigned and Roy Davidson, Larry Ieropoli, and Kevin (Bohler - I think) were elected. The Hearing Committee was reappointed. The 2002 and 2003 Financials were approved. All Neighborhoods that are built out are being prepared for turnover. Liability insurance is being raised from $1 Million to $5 Million. And amendment is being prepared to the by-laws and will be explained in a future letter to the resients. A Capitalization policy was established for anything with a life of more than 1 year and over $1000. Legal Council, Dean Mead, Minton, and Zwemer from Fort Pierce was hired. A revision is being made to the "basketball" provision of the architechtural review conditions. More details will be available at next meeting. There will be a July Board of Directors meeting with notice coming in the above mentioned letter. Roy Davidson expects turnover to take 3-4 more years. The next project that will be for sale is Maidstone North. Madeleine Warns asked about street lights in Kingsmill. Roy Davidson said he was meeting with representatives of FPL on Friday but he had heard they were back ordered 3-4 months. Bob Simons asked what was happening regarding the 2002- 2003 Road Survey. Roy Davidson was not aware of it. David Guzy indicated that he would review it. Many questions were asked regarding the Island Club. Roy Davidson indicated that the design of the building is set, Kolter plans to leave it at the previously proposed location, and is considering an entrance from Village Parkway. Numerous questions were asked about the financial statements and about how the $12,000 refund from Adelphia would be allocated.
